Join Buffalo Bayou Partnership for our annual gala, a memorable evening outdoors at Buffalo Bayou Park to celebrate our organization’s Milestones in Motion.  Guests will enjoy cocktails and a seated dinner underneath a spectacular tent on the lawn with stunning views of downtown Houston, all in support of BBP’s forward motion towards a more connected and welcoming waterfront for all of Houston.

This year, BBP is marking many important milestones—from the 10th anniversary of the transformation of Buffalo Bayou Park to significant progress realizing the Buffalo Bayou East 10-Year Plan including the completion of a new hike and bike trail segment, new green space at the Lockwood on Buffalo Bayou affordable housing development, and the first phase of our Turkey Bend site.

Buffalo Bayou Partnership Regatta

MARCH 21, 2026

The BBP Regatta is the largest canoe and kayak race in Texas, stretching 15 miles from San Felipe (just west of Voss) to downtown. Finish line festivities at Allen’s Landing include music, lunch for participants, and an awards ceremony. Paddlers, ages 12 and up, are encouraged to participate in this longstanding Houston tradition in support of Buffalo Bayou.
